| Aspect | Cybersecurity Policy Analyst | Cybersecurity Analyst |
|---|---|---|
| Required Credentials | Bachelor's in cybersecurity, IT, or related field; certifications like CISSP, CISA | Bachelor's in cybersecurity, IT, or related field; certifications like CompTIA Security+ or CISSP |
| Work Environment | Policy development, compliance, and strategic planning in office settings | Technical security monitoring, incident response, and system analysis |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Government agencies, corporations, consulting firms focusing on security policies | IT departments, security firms, and organizations managing technical security |
The main difference is that a Cybersecurity Policy Analyst focuses on creating and managing security policies and ensuring compliance, while a Cybersecurity Analyst handles technical security measures and threat mitigation. Both roles require similar credentials but serve different functions within cybersecurity teams.

Major Duties
The U.S. Army Cyber Protection Brigade (CPB) also known as the "Hunter" brigade is Army's premier cyber threat hunter. We hunt advanced adversaries to enable information advantage in multi-domain operations and maintain and defend strategic cyber infrastructure. We are comprised of 1,300-plus specially trained and mission-focused Soldiers and civilians who work as a cohesive team to drive cyberspace operations and impose cost on our nation's enemies.
The incumbent will serves as a Host Analyst for a U.S. Army Cyber Protection Team (CPT) in the U.S. Army Cyber Protection Brigade (CPB). The incumbent will knowledge of system/server and host based forensics to enable cyber security operations. The cyber role of a Host Analyst performs hunt, clear, enable hardening, as well as provide Cyber Threat Emulation (CTE) and Discovery and Counter-Infiltration (D&CI) capabilities.

To qualify based on your experience, your resume must describe one-year of specialized experience that demonstrates the possession of knowledge, skills, abilities, and competencies necessary for immediate success in the position. Such experience is typically in or directly related to the work of the position to be filled. Specialized
experience would be demonstrated by:
GG-07: Assisting in performing surveys and evaluating network traffic to identify baselines, trends, anomalous traffic, and potential malicious cyberspace activities; and assisting in incident response process and threat mitigation and development of mitigations and threat counter measures.
GG-09: Updating security patches in compliance with Cybersecurity policy/ regulations; and collecting information from customers to be used in the restoration of network services.
GG-11: Detecting anomalies in host data; monitoring enterprise tools for potential intrusions; and mitigating threats by keeping tools up to date with the latest approved system and security releases.
GG-12: Installing, operating, maintaining, configuring, testing, and/or securing hardware and software-based operating System (OS) environments (for example Microsoft Windows and Linux); analyzing network or host data and devices to recognize anomalous behavior/artifacts; determining the stage(s) of an intrusion (for example using network and/or host artifacts, along with possible use of software, to determine what stage of the cyber kill chain that a potential adversary is in); and creating threat reporting and/or briefing based on analysis. The specialized experience must include, or be supplemented by, information technology related experience (paid or unpaid experience and/or completion of specific, intensive training, as appropriate) which demonstrates each of the four competencies, as defined:
(1) Attention to Detail - Is thorough when performing work and conscientious about attending to detail.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: completing work independently that rarely requires editing or review by others
(2) Customer Service - Works with clients and customers (that is, any individuals who use or receive the services or products that your work unit produces, including the general public, individuals who work in the agency, other agencies, or organizations outside the Government) to assess their needs, provide information or assistance, resolve their problems, or satisfy their expectations; knows about available products and services; is committed to providing quality products and services.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: resolving simple and routine problems, questions, or complaints and providing support and guidance to customers on non-routine issues; serving as a primary resource for customers, requesting assistance with complex issues when necessary; and participating in meetings and providing advice to customers in own area of expertise.
(3) Oral Communication - Expresses information (for example, ideas or facts) to individuals or groups effectively, taking into account the audience and nature of the information (for example, technical, sensitive, controversial); makes clear and convincing oral presentations; listens to others, attends to nonverbal cues, and responds appropriately.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: expressing facts and ideas in a clear, concise, convincing, and organized manner; clearly conveying moderately complex ideas, concepts, and information to customers; exhibiting active listening by demonstrating understanding of audience comments and/or questions.
(4) Problem Solving - Identifies problems; determines accuracy and relevance of information; uses sound judgment to generate and evaluate alternatives, and to make recommendations.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: identifying and solving problems by gathering and applying information from a variety of materials or sources that provide several alternatives; recognizing and taking action to address non-routine problems; soliciting feedback from multiple stakeholders to understand an issue or problem and accurately assess its root causes and potential solutions; seeking supervisory review where appropriate.
EDUCATION:
GG-07 Substitution of Education for Experience: One full year of graduate level education from an accredited or pre-accredited institution in computer science, engineering, information science, information systems management, mathematics, operations research, statistics, or technology management; or, graduate level education from an accredited or pre-accredited institution that provided a minimum of 24 semester hours in one or more of the fields identified above and required the development or adaptation of applications, systems, or networks.
OR
Superior Academic Achievement: Successful completion of all the requirements for a bachelor's degree from an accredited or pre-accredited institution in computer science, engineering, information science, information systems management, mathematics, operations research, statistics, or technology management; or, bachelor's degree from an accredited or pre-accredited institution that provided a minimum of 24 semester hours in one or more of the fields identified above and required the development or adaptation of applications, systems, or networks. Superior Academic Achievement is based on:
(1) Class Standing - You must be in the upper third of the graduating class in the college, university, or major subdivision, such as the College of Liberal Arts or the School of Business Administration, based on completed courses; OR
(2) Grade-Point Average (G.P.A.) - You must have a grade-point average of either (a) 3.0 or higher out of a possible 4.0 ("B" or better) as recorded on your official transcript, or as computed based on 4 years of education, or as computed based on courses completed during the final 2 years of the curriculum; or (b) 3.5 or higher out of a possible 4.0 ("B+" or better) based on the average of the required courses completed in the major field or the required courses in the major field completed during the final 2 years of the curriculum.; OR (3) Honor Society Membership - You may be considered eligible based on membership in one of the approved national scholastic honor societies listed by the Association of College Honor Societies (https://www.achshonor.org/).
GG-09 Substitution of Education for Experience: Master's or equivalent graduate degree or 2 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ree from an accredited or pre-accredited institution in computer science, engineering, information science, information systems management, mathematics, operations research, statistics, or technology management; or, two full years of graduate education from an accredited or pre-accredited institution that provided a minimum of 24 semester hours in one or more of the fields identified above and required the development or adaptation of applications, systems, or networks.
GG-11 Substitution of Education for Experience: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ree or 3 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ree from an accredited or pre-accredited institution in computer science, engineering, information science, information systems management, mathematics, operations research, statistics, or technology management; or, three full years of graduate education from an accredited or pre-accredited institution that provided a minimum of 24 semester hours in one or more of the fields identified above and required the development or adaptation of applications, systems, or networks.
GG-12 You must meet the qualification requirement using experience alone--no substitution of education for experience is permitted.
FOREIGN EDUCATION: If you are using education completed in foreign colleges or universities to meet the qualification requirements, you must show the education credentials have been evaluated by a private organization that specializes in interpretation of foreign education programs and such education has been deemed equivalent to that gained in an accredited U.S. education program; or full credit has been given for the courses at a U.S. accredited college or university.
